Flexibility is the new injustice inflicted on the working class

by
Phillip Inman
from Economics | The Guardian on (#1EKCK)
Story ImageGlobalisation is often blamed for falling living standards. But the role of flexible working and self-employment in blighting people's lives is being overlooked

The rise of Nigel Farage, Donald Trump and Marine Le Pen is often blamed on the angry, reaction of blue-collar workers to decades of falling living standards.

The financial crash of 2008 only served to make the situation worse. And so the west finds itself in the grip of powerful protest movements that seek to brush aside failing, sclerotic institutions like the US congress and EU parliament in favour of more locally democratic administrations (or possibly right-of-centre governments with autocratic leaders).
